LUA file removal via SSH

I am following the guidance posted at UI4 – DSC Alarm Panel for integrating Vera2 with a DSC 1832 alarm panel. One of the first recommendations states “If the previous DSC plug-in was installed, then it is recommended to uninstall it first, and then remove the plug-in files from the via SSH”. The recommendation doesn’t get any more specific than this and I don’t want to just start deleting files.

Old DSC files appear in the /etc/cmh-ludl/ and /overlay/etc/cmh-ludl/ directories. Does the recommendation to remove previously installed plug-in files mean that I need to delete all files from both of these directories?

Thanks - M

Just remove the files in /etc/cmh-ludl and you should be fine. Just make sure you are removing the files marked with dsc.
